Instead of simply "programming" a smart AI, their matrix is created by scanning and replicating the neural pathways of a [[human]] brain.<ref>'''[[Halo: The Fall of Reach]]''', ''pages 235-236''</ref> This process destroys the original brain tissue, and so the brain being used is typically obtained after the host is dead.<ref>'''Dr. Halsey's personal journal''', ''May 21, 2549''</ref> This process is still inefficient, however, as neural linkages are "wasted" in the process of the budding AI generating its own system of more efficient neural linkages to replace those of the seed brain, in turn eroding the AI's limited lifespan.<ref>'''Dr. Halsey's personal journal''', ''May 3, 2526''</ref>

Because of the nature of this process the smart AI often retains residual thoughts, memories and/or feelings from the brain donor.<ref>'''[[Halo Encyclopedia (2009 edition)]]''', ''page 229''</ref> These residuals can be anything from the "feeling" of a hair brush being pulled through hair (in the case of [[Sif]]),<ref>'''Halo: Contact Harvest''', ''page 33''</ref> to an effect on the mannerisms and characteristics that make up the personality of an AI, in the case of Cortana and her likeness to Dr. Catherine Halsey as well as her possessing many of Halsey's memories, which surfaced during her descent into rampancy.<ref>'''Halo 4''', campaign level ''[[Composer (level)|Composer]]''</ref> When [[the Weapon]] is created from another one of Dr. Halsey's cloned brains, she is described as an exact copy of Cortana with the same routines and systems, but without all of her knowledge and history. While talking to [[John-117]] about the Weapon, Halsey refers to her as "a blank slate."<ref name="Audio logs">''[[Audio log (Halo_Infinite)|Audio logs]]''</ref>{{Ref/Game|Id=Hi|Hi}}
